Your teacher will assign your group one of situations below. Create a visual display about your situation that includes:
- An equation that represents your situation
- What your variable and each term in the equation represent
- How the operations in the equation represent the relationships in the story
- How you use inverses to solve for the unknown quantity
- The solution to your equation
- As a inch candle burns down, its height decreases inch each hour. How many hours does it take for the candle to burn completely?
- On Monday of the enrolled students in a school were absent. There were 4,512 students present. How many students are enrolled at the school?
- A hiker begins at sea level and descents 25 feet every minute. How long will it take to get to an elevation of -750 feet?
- Jada practices the violin for the same amount of time every day. On Tuesday she practices for 35 minutes. How much does Jada practice in a week?
- The temperature has been dropping degrees every hour and the current temperature is . How many hours ago was the temperature ?
- The population of a school increased by 12%, and now the population is 476. What was the population before the increase?
- During a 5% off sale, Diego pays $74.10 for a new hockey stick. What was the original price?
- A store buys sweaters for $8 and sells them for $26. How many sweaters does the store need to sell to make a profit of $990?


Diego and Elena are 2 miles apart and begin walking towards each other. Diego walks at a rate of 3.7 miles per hour and Elena walks 4.3 miles per hour. While they are walking, Elena's dog runs back and forth between the two of them, at a rate of 6 miles per hour. Assuming the dog does not lose any time in turning around, how far has the dog run by the time Diego and Elena reach each other?

Match this situation with one of the equations.
A whale was diving at a rate of 2 meters per second. How long will it take for the whale to get from the surface of the ocean to an elevation of -12 meters at that rate?
A swimmer dove below the surface of the ocean. After 2 minutes, she was 12 meters below the surface. At what rate was she diving?
The temperature was -12 degrees Celsius and rose to 2 degrees Celsius. What was the change in temperature?
The temperature was 2 degrees Celsius and fell to -12 degrees Celsius. What was the change in temperature?
